The Landscape of High-Reward Slot Machines
Modern slot machines, especially those found on the vibrant floors of Las Vegas or within digital platforms, are meticulously engineered to balance entertainment with profitability. Among the various tiers, high-reward slots—often termed “high volatility” machines—offer infrequent but substantial payouts, appealing to high-stakes players seeking life-changing wins.
For example, a typical high-volatility slot might feature a maximum payout (or jackpot) that can reach several tens of thousands of pounds. These jackpots, sometimes expressed as “max wins,” have become a key point of interest for both players and regulators. Regulatory Considerations & Responsible Gaming
While the allure of a big win is undeniable, regulators across the UK and internationally impose strict guidelines to prevent player exploitative behaviour. Slot machines managed through licensed operators must adhere to minimum return-to-player (RTP) percentages, often hovering around 85–98%, depending on jurisdiction and game type.
